Ordinals
beta
Sat 771991412352247
decimal
154398.1412352247
degree
0°154398′1182″1412352247‴
percentile
36.76149586673514%
name
ijoipdkkmwg
cycle
0
epoch
0
period
76
block
154398
offset
1412352247
timestamp
2011-11-22 21:56:43 UTC
rarity
common
prev
next